The 2024 Ontario Sunshine List shows that the average and median salaries for a Corporate Chief Information Officer are $192,981.86 and $207,089.40, respectively.
In 2024, Mohammad Qureshi, holding the position of Corporate Chief Information Officer at the Public and Business Service Delivery received the highest salary of $277,532.49 among similar positions in Ontario public organizations.
In the year 2024, the highest-paying organizations for Corporate Chief Information Officer and similar positions in the Ontario were as follows: Natural Resources and Forestry with an average pay of $219,680.84; County of Peterborough with an average pay of $210,699.30; Winchester District Memorial Hospital with an average pay of $207,089.40; Cambridge Memorial Hospital with an average pay of $186,277.36; and Public and Business Service Delivery with an average pay of $175,708.78.
A total of 5 organizations had employees who held comparable positions as mentioned in the Ontario Sunshine list.
In the year 2024, the highest-paying sector or industries for Corporate Chief Information Officer and similar positions in the Ontario were as follows: Municipalities and Services with an average pay of $210,699.30; Hospitals and Boards of Public Health with an average pay of $196,683.38; and Government of Ontario - Ministries with an average pay of $186,701.79.
There were 3 sectors where employees held similar positions, as indicated in the Ontario Sunshine list.
The 2024 Ontario Sunshine List indicates that the representation of gender diversity in Corporate Chief Information Officer is 28.57% male and 71.43% female, respectively.
